Key Qualities to Look for in a Data Engineering Recruiter

As data engineering becomes more integral to building data-driven infrastructure, choosing a recruitment firm with a thorough understanding of this field is essential for companies. A skilled recruiter in data engineering comprehends the technical expertise professionals need—such as building data pipelines, managing ETL processes, and working with cloud platforms—and also knows where to find the best talent and what data engineers value in a role.

A recruitment firm’s reputation and track record of successful placements are important indicators of quality. Review client testimonials, case studies, and performance metrics for similar roles. Beyond just successful initial placements, look for evidence that the recruiter’s placements perform well over time. Firms that consistently place candidates who succeed in their roles demonstrate the ability to match talent to the company effectively.

The breadth and diversity of a recruiter’s network are also critical factors. A wide-ranging network can accelerate the search for the right fit, but it’s also valuable for a recruiter to have access to diverse talent pools, introducing candidates with varied backgrounds and perspectives, including those who might not appear through traditional channels.

Finally, assess the recruiter’s process and communication approach. A top recruiter takes time to understand your company’s specific needs and each role’s requirements. For candidates, a quality recruiter respects your career goals and values your technical expertise. Look for clear processes, open communication, and a dedicated contact who can address any questions or issues that arise throughout the hiring process.

Tips for Data Engineering Candidates to Find the Right Recruiter

For data engineers, working with a recruiter who understands your technical skill set and career aspirations can be highly beneficial. Start by asking for recommendations from colleagues or industry groups; firsthand feedback can help you find a recruiter who grasps the nuances of data engineering and aligns with your career goals.

Research the recruiter’s past clients and partnerships, often highlighted on their website, to understand the kinds of roles they specialize in and whether these match your objectives. Also, evaluate the level of support each recruiter offers; some are hands-on throughout the application, interview, and onboarding stages, while others take a more reserved approach. Choosing a recruiter who provides the right level of support can improve your job search experience.

Tips for Employers Selecting the Right Data Engineering Recruitment Firm

When evaluating recruitment firms for data engineering roles, start by clarifying your hiring needs and assessing the range of services each firm offers. Some agencies focus on direct hires, while others specialize in contract and temp-to-hire placements or even building entire data teams. Knowing your hiring goals will help you identify a recruiter who aligns with the type of placement you need.

Consider whether the recruiter specializes in your field. While many agencies cover a broad spectrum of roles, those specializing in technology, engineering, or data are better equipped to fill complex data engineering roles that require niche skills. Working with a recruiter who understands technical positions can improve your chances of finding candidates with the exact skills and experience required.

Look for recruiters who can adapt their approach to meet unique hiring demands. Each role may have distinct requirements, and the most successful firms recognize this, tailoring their recruitment strategy accordingly. During initial discussions, ask about their approach and how they can customize their methods to fit your needs.
